Customs & paperwork, handled

Since the UK left the EU, moving your belongings to the Continent means a customs declaration and a detailed inventory, plus transit documents for the crossing. For used household effects there are reliefs you may qualify for as someone transferring residence. We prepare the declarations, explain what you need to provide, and manage the border side so your goods do not sit waiting — you will not be handed a stack of forms and left to it.

Do you move homes and businesses from Margate to Europe?

Both. We run European removals from Margate for households relocating abroad and for smaller commercial moves. Larger consignments travel as a dedicated load; smaller ones share a vehicle with other moves on the same route.

Is Margate a good starting point for a European move?

Honestly, yes — the Kent coast has a head start. Dover and the Eurotunnel at Folkestone are just along the coast, so the crossing is a short hop rather than a long haul to reach, before the drive on the far side begins.

What happens with customs now the UK has left the EU?

A move to the EU needs a customs declaration and a detailed inventory of your goods, and for used household effects there are reliefs you may qualify for when transferring residence. We prepare the paperwork, tell you what to provide, and manage the transit documents so your goods clear the border cleanly.

How long will a European move take?

It depends on the destination, the crossing, customs clearance and whether you have a dedicated or shared load. Your written quote gives an estimated window for your specific route rather than a blanket promise.
